Keep Food Safe Without Constant Ice Runs
Ice may seem like a simple solution, but it becomes less reliable the longer your trip lasts. No matter how carefully you pack your cooler, the ice will eventually melt, raising the inside temperature and reducing how long your food stays safe to eat. However, a mobile cooler is designed to eliminate that problem by using compressors to maintain a constant temperature throughout your trip, even for several days at a time.
Of course, bringing frozen food before departure and packaging it properly will make a difference, particularly at the beginning of your journey. The USDA also recommends freezing food before leaving and packing it with a reliable cold source to help keep it at a safe temperature during outdoor trips. However, no matter how good your packaging method is, it can only keep food cold for a limited amount of time. A compressor-cooler operates continuously, so there is no need to rely on melting ice to keep food cold . This means you’ll make fewer stops to buy ice and spend less time worrying about food spoilage.

Run On Power You Already Have In Your Rig
One reason mobile coolers fit overlanding so well is that they plug directly into infrastructure most rigs already carry. A typical unit runs on 12- or 24-volt DC power straight from your vehicle, on standard AC power at a campsite, or from a portable battery or solar setup when you are fully off-grid. This flexibility is exactly what makes 12-volt fridges suited to serious overlanders and long-distance travelers who need dependable cooling without babysitting an ice supply.
Modern units also include battery protection systems that stop drawing power before your starter battery drains too far, so you are not left stranded just because you wanted cold drinks. That combination of flexible power input and built-in safeguards is difficult to replicate with anything that relies purely on ice.
